Alliant Credit Union Employees Pull A Cargo Jet To Raise Money For Special Olympics Illinois

10/21/2011

Two teams of 20 employees each from Chicago-based Alliant Credit Union recently participated in the 2011 Plane Pull to benefit Special Olympics Illinois, held at Chicago's O'Hare International Airport. The Alliant teams competed among 25 others from Chicago area public safety, service and business communities who pulled a UPS cargo aircraft 12 feet in a tug-of-war style event.

Alliant Credit Union’s Blue Team members pose happily after pulling giant cargo jet across the finish line. Alliant’s charitable foundation donated $50 to Special Olympics Illinois on behalf of each participating employee volunteer.

Alliant Credit Union Foundation donated money to Special Olympics on behalf of the credit union's employee volunteers by paying their $50 Plane Pull registration fees totaling $2,000 for the 40 Alliant employee volunteers. According to Ms. Sandy Beckman, Alliant's Supervisor of Member & Special Services, who coordinated the credit union's Plane Pull involvement, "Pulling that plane along the runway was unbelievable, and we really loved helping Special Olympics."

Headquartered near O'Hare Airport at Touhy Avenue and Wolf Road, Alliant Credit Union was founded in 1935. It is America's sixth largest credit union in asset size with $7.8 billion in assets and 280,000 members nationwide. Alliant's members include employees, family members and retirees of United Airlines and other select employee groups, along with people who live or work in qualifying communities in the Chicago area.
